After 18-year-old Hanna disappeared in Uddevalla, the police are now starting a murder investigation, reports P4 West.
There is still no indication that a crime has been committed.
– It is to be able to search more broadly, says Martin Öhman, police area manager to the channel.
18-year-old Hanna has been missing since January 6, when she was last seen in central Uddevalla.
On Wednesday, the police launched a massive search effort, after clothes believed to belong to the woman were found in an exercise area a short distance outside Uddevalla.
Among other things, they have searched with helicopters, drones, dogs and patrols. The Swedish Armed Forces and Missing people are also connected.
There is nothing concrete to indicate that a crime has been committed. The police say they have drawn up a report of murder to get more powers.
– It is to further open our toolbox to be able to search even wider and deeper for the missing person, says Martin Öhman to P4.
